1934-1946 and most older bodies. Nice copy of the original popular era accessory attaches to side of cab with two brackets. Exact duplicate of a once very popular style with small red ball on top and double attachment on cowl in front of door. (The upper attachment slides on the antenna shaft so it fits most all older vehicles.) Stainless mast and hand polished chrome trim caps. Show quality!.Jim Carter Trivia: During the early years one manufacturer placed an attractive small RED ball at the top. This was to attract attention to others that your vehicle had a radio. Radios were a rare expensive accessory in the early years.
